hematopoietic system
• following whole body irradiation, the numbe rof YFP+ platelets decreases by 2-fold after day 6 of exposure
• YFP+ platelets are more responsive to thrombin stimulation than YFP- platelets within the same mouse

homeostasis/metabolism
• unlike platelet-rich plasma (PRP) from wild-type controls which complete the retraction of opaque thrombin-induced clots within a 2-hr period, heterozygous PRP shows both a delayed and incomplete clot retraction during this period
• heterozygous platelets display a specific fibrinogen binding capacity of 57% relative to 100% in wild-type platelets
• although heterozygous platelets exhibit substantial aggregation in response to ADP or collagen, the collagen response is significantly delayed relative to that in wild-type controls
